• Delivery times may vary based on location.#@@#deliverynotes#@#NA#@@#Maintenance Guide#@#Inspect the Thunder Group Y-35 Shiraki wood tray before each shift. Remove food residue with a soft brush to prevent buildup. Clean with mild, food-safe detergent and warm water; rinse and dry immediately with a lint-free cloth to avoid warping. Oil the surface monthly with food-grade mineral oil, apply evenly, let penetrate for 15 minutes, then wipe excess. Store flat in a cool, dry area away from heat and sunlight. Rotate stock to balance wear and replace trays with deep cracks or splintering.
